The Cell of the Holy Archangels is one of the oldest buildings in Karyes, the capital of the Holy Mount Athos. It is also home to the brotherhood’s most revered treasure: the icon of the Archangel Michael and the Heavenly Host.
Today, due to severe decay, the roof of the cell is on the verge of collapse. This threatens not only the ancient building itself, but also the church’s wall paintings and the holy relics kept within.
While efforts to restore the roof are underway, the cost of repairs far exceeds the brotherhood's modest means. Furthermore, construction work on Mount Athos is significantly more expensive due to the remoteness and isolation of the monastic community.
At present, only three monks live in the cell. Their sole craft and source of income is the art of iconography.
The restoration must be completed before the rainy season begins.
